>Number: 183032 >Category: kern >Synopsis: uep driver not working with eGalax touchcontroller >Confidential: no >Severity: non-critical >Priority: low >Responsible: freebsd-bugs >State: open >Quarter: >Keywords: >Date-Required: >Class: sw-bug >Submitter-Id: current-users >Arrival-Date: Wed Oct 16 20:00:00 UTC 2013 >Closed-Date: >Last-Modified: >Originator: Ian >Release: 9.2-RELEASE >Organization: >Environment: FreeBSD tsconsole.local 9.2-RELEASE FreeBSD 9.2-RELEASE #0 r255898: Fri Sep 27 03:52:52 UTC 2013 root@bake.isc.freebsd.org:/usr/obj/usr/src/sys/GENERIC i386 >Description: eGalax Touchscreens don't appear to be working with FreeBSD 9.2. This has been an ongoing problem, I think, since the 8.x branch. Please refer to these links for existing similar reports: http://149.20.54.209/showthread.php?p=158199 http://forums.freebsd.org/archive/index.php/t-28521.html Major Points: - uep finds the touchscreen and assigns it to /dev/uep0 - uep0 does not offer any data when the touchscreen events happen - I have made the appropriate changes to xorg.conf (attached as xorg.txt) - The touchscreen does not function in Xorg; no cursor movement ever happens. - The touchscreen is known to work under Windows XP Embedded and Linux (via the evtouch driver) Lines from dmesg that are important: > dmesg | grep -iE 'ums|uhid|uep|galax' ugen3.2: <eGalax Inc.> at usbus3 uep0: <eGalax Inc. USB TouchController, class 0/0, rev 1.10/1.00, addr 2> on usbus3 usbconfig output for the touchscreen: > usbconfig -u 3 -a 2 dump_device_desc ugen3.2: <USB TouchController eGalax Inc.> at usbus3, cfg=0 md=HOST spd=FULL (12Mbps) pwr=ON (100mA) bLength = 0x0012 bDescriptorType = 0x0001 bcdUSB = 0x0110 bDeviceClass = 0x0000 bDeviceSubClass = 0x0000 bDeviceProtocol = 0x0000 bMaxPacketSize0 = 0x0040 idVendor = 0x0eef idProduct = 0x0001 bcdDevice = 0x0100 iManufacturer = 0x0001 <eGalax Inc.> iProduct = 0x0002 <USB TouchController> iSerialNumber = 0x0000 <no string> bNumConfigurations = 0x0001 Please let me know if any more information could be helpful.
